2013-04-02: v1.0.15-rc1
* Improve tranfer cancellation and avoid short read failures on broken descriptors
* Filter out 8-bit characters in libusb_get_string_descriptor_ascii()
* Add WinCE support
* Add library stress tests
* Add FX3 firmware upload support for fxload
* Add HID and kernel driver detach support capabilities detection
* Add SuperSpeed detection on OS X
* Fix issues with autoclaim, composite HID devices, interface autoclaim and
early abort in libusb_close() on Windows. Also add VS 2012 solution files.
* Improve fd event handling on Linux
* Other bug fixes and improvements
